Childress Municipal’s two published approaches use different navigation methods—RNAV (GPS) and VOR—but both serve the same runway end. Published instrument access is therefore concentrated on one direction, with no approach procedure for the other three ends. The two runway alignments provide different headings, although 18/36 offers 1,524 ft more pavement length than 04/22.

Childress Muni has 2 runways. The longest is 18/36 at 5,949 ft by 75 ft, asphalt. Full runway dimensions, lighting and approach aids are listed on this page.
No ILS is published. In total KCDS has 2 published instrument approaches, of which 1 are RNAV (GPS).
Every published approach serves one runway end. There is no instrument procedure to the reciprocal direction, so an arrival in instrument conditions commits to that single approach direction regardless of the wind.
No — Childress Muni has no control tower. Traffic co-ordinates on a common frequency rather than with a controller, which is listed in the frequencies table on this page.
